Get your popcorn ready. Norwegian sibling duo Hella the Movie live up to their name from the very first seconds, as their debut single On My Way unfolds more like a film soundtrack than a standard single.
Siblings Frida and Gard Songstad Hella, hailing from the idyllic Norwegian mountain town of Geilo, arrive with a soulful debut built on space, warmth and a graceful ease.
As the guitar-led track opens, it creates a three-dimensional sound stage where harmonious vocals slowly emerge and carry you along.
The smoothness of this single cannot be understated. Dreamy without slipping into wistfulness, the folk, soulful elegance and emotional honesty pull you in quickly. It feels instantly immersive, as if time slows down, encouraging you to close your eyes and drift into pure escapism.
‘On My Way‘ is a song about longing, vulnerability, and the desire to be truly seen and understood, explained Hella the Movie. It explores connection to other people, to ourselves, and to the parts of life that make us feel whole.
Musical siblings are not as uncommon in music as one might think, with names like Billie Eilish, The Carpenters, and the Scandinavian soul sibling duo The Endorphins. There is often a distinct chemistry between two musicians sharing a common language, and here that connection feels very present.

‘On My Way’ is the first glimpse of their forthcoming debut EP, Biorhythm, due in autumn 2026. It is produced by soul artist and producer Ann Weberg and Ole Petter Oras Ålgård (Spellemann-nominated for Nom de Guerre), and was written in the aftermath of losing their father.
